Obverse description Grey-green note with black letterpress text arranged in two parallel columns, Polish on the left and German on the right. A Polish eagle vignette is printed in the centre. The text constitutes a payment order drawn on the communal district treasury in Wejherowo, dated 14 February 1920, and bears the printed titles of the Starosta (District Head) and Treasurer.
Obverse lettering Przekaz na 50 fen. Płatny w kasie powiatowej komunalnej w Wejherowie Wejherowo, dnia 14 lutego 1920r Starosta Skarbnik

Comments

Wejherowo had only just been incorporated into the reborn Polish state when this note was issued — the town transferred from German administration under the Treaty of Versailles provisions that took effect in January 1920, and the local district office was issuing emergency fractional currency almost immediately. The timing was not coincidental. Small-denomination coins were essentially absent from circulation in the newly absorbed western territories, where the German mark was being displaced and the Polish marka had not yet penetrated in useful quantity.

District-level emergency issues from Pomerania in this transitional window are among the least documented of all Polish local currency, with surviving print runs rarely reconstructed with any confidence.
